Can Neck Pain Cause Headaches?

The simple answer is yes. Research suggests that up to 90% of people with migraine or tension-type headaches also experience neck pain. However, having neck pain alongside a headache doesn’t necessarily mean the neck is causing it.

Research has also identified changes in neck mobility, muscle function, and joint function in some people with persistent headaches. The neck and head are closely connected, and in certain types of headaches, structures in the neck can contribute to pain that is felt in the head.

What Is a Cervicogenic Headache?

A cervicogenic headache (CGH) is classified by the International Headache Society as a secondary headache, meaning the headache is caused by a problem elsewhere in the body—in this case, the neck.

The pain originates from structures in the cervical spine (neck) but is felt in the head. This is known as referred pain: the source of the problem and the location where you feel the pain are not always the same.

What Does a Cervicogenic Headache Feel Like?

Cervicogenic headaches can share some features with migraines and tension-type headaches, which can make them difficult to distinguish without a thorough clinical assessment. However, there are certain characteristics that may suggest the neck is contributing to your headache.

Common Symptoms 

Common features of cervicogenic headaches can include:

  • Pain starting in the neck: Pain often begins in the neck or at the base of the skull and travels forward toward the front of the head or behind the eyes.

  • One-sided pain: The headache is commonly felt on one side of the head and typically stays on the same side.

  • Worsening with neck movement or prolonged positions: Head pain may be triggered or aggravated by certain neck movements or sustained positions, such as looking down at a laptop or sitting at a desk for long periods.

  • Neck stiffness and reduced mobility: You may notice that your neck feels stiff or tight or that you have difficulty turning or moving it as freely as usual.

  • Shoulder or arm pain: Some people also experience pain that extends into the shoulder or arm on the same side as the headache.

  • Tenderness in the neck: Pressing on certain muscles or joints around the neck or base of the skull may reproduce or worsen familiar headache symptoms.

Why Your Headaches Keep Coming Back

Pain Relief Doesn’t Always Fix the Problem

When a severe headache strikes, the immediate priority is finding relief. You might reach for over-the-counter pain medication, apply a heat pack, or book a massage to help alleviate tension in your neck and shoulders. While these approaches can help reduce symptoms, they may not address the factors contributing to why your headaches keep returning.

If your neck is contributing to your headaches, restricted movement in the upper neck or reduced strength and endurance in the muscles that support it may play a role. In these cases, the pain may return even after the initial symptoms have settled.

For longer-term improvement, it is important to look beyond symptom relief and identify the specific factors that may be placing additional strain on your neck. These can include joint mobility, muscular strength and endurance, posture, and movement patterns.

A comprehensive rehabilitation approach aims to address these contributing factors by improving joint mobility, building muscular endurance, and helping you move more comfortably and efficiently during your everyday activities.

Why We Don’t Just Treat the Neck

When you have a stiff neck and a headache, it can be tempting to focus treatment exclusively on the cervical spine. However, the neck doesn’t work in isolation. It is part of a connected system—or kinetic chain—that includes the upper back and shoulders.

The Neck and Upper Back Work Together

Your cervical spine sits directly on top of your thoracic spine (your upper and mid-back). If your upper back is stiff or has limited mobility—something that can develop with prolonged desk work—your neck may have to compensate to help you look around and move normally.

Over time, this additional demand on the neck may contribute to irritation of the joints and surrounding muscles and, in some people, may play a role in recurring cervicogenic headaches.

How Shoulder Function Can Influence Headaches

Several muscles that attach to your neck, including the upper trapezius and levator scapulae, also attach to your shoulder blades. This means that the way your shoulders and shoulder blades move can influence the demands placed on your neck.

If your shoulder mechanics or scapular muscle function are not optimal, everyday activities such as lifting your arms, typing on a keyboard, or carrying a heavy bag may place additional demand on the muscles around your neck and shoulders.

Why Strength and Endurance Matter

You might be strong enough to lift heavy weights at the gym, but do the deep stabilizing muscles of your neck have the endurance to support your head throughout an eight-hour workday?

Reduced endurance in the deep neck flexors and postural muscles can make it harder for these muscles to manage prolonged positions throughout the day. This may increase the workload on the muscles and joints around the upper neck and base of the skull, potentially contributing to irritation and recurring headaches.

How We Assess Neck-Related Headaches

A thorough clinical examination is essential when assessing cervicogenic headaches and developing an individualized treatment plan. We look beyond the site of the pain to identify the factors contributing to your headaches.

Neck Mobility

We carefully assess both your active range of motion—how your neck moves on its own—and passive range of motion, where the clinician moves your neck for you.

One clinical test we use is the Cervical Flexion-Rotation Test (CFRT). This test assesses movement in the upper cervical spine by gently rotating your head while your neck is positioned in flexion. Research has found that people with cervicogenic headaches often have more restricted movement during this test compared with people without headaches and those with migraines.

Upper Back Mobility

We evaluate the stiffness and mobility of your thoracic spine (upper and mid-back). Because your upper back and neck work together during everyday movement, restricted upper back mobility can place additional demands on the cervical spine and contribute to the headache cycle.

Posture and Ergonomics

We look at your posture while sitting, standing, and moving, as well as whether certain positions reproduce or aggravate your symptoms. We also discuss your daily ergonomic setup at work or home to identify prolonged positions or habits that may be contributing to your headaches.

Muscle Function and Strength

Research has identified reduced neck muscle strength and endurance in people with cervicogenic headaches. We assess the function of the deep muscles at the front of your neck using the cranio-cervical flexion test (CCFT), a clinical test that looks at how well these important stabilizing muscles activate and maintain control.

This helps us identify whether muscle strength or endurance needs to be addressed as part of your rehabilitation.

Identifying Contributing Factors

We also take a thorough history and look at factors beyond strength and mobility that may be contributing to or aggravating your headaches. These can include stress, diet, sleep quality, sleeping position, pillows, mattresses, and other aspects of your daily routine.

Looking at the bigger picture helps us understand what may be driving your symptoms and build a treatment plan around your individual needs.

How Chiropractic Rehab Helps Cervicogenic Headaches

Improving Joint Mobility

Research supports manual therapy for reducing headache intensity, frequency, and disability in people with cervicogenic headaches. Treatment may include high-velocity low-amplitude (HVLA) spinal manipulation—a quick, controlled movement applied to a specific joint—as well as gentler joint mobilization techniques.

Techniques targeting the upper cervical spine, including the C1-C2 region, can help restore movement in restricted joints and reduce symptoms.

Reducing Muscle Tension

We use various soft tissue techniques, including instrument-assisted soft tissue mobilization, ischemic compression, and myofascial release, to help reduce muscle tension and sensitivity around the neck and shoulders. Improving Neck Function

By combining spinal manipulation or joint mobilization with soft tissue therapies, we can improve joint mobility, reduce muscle tension, and improve the overall function of the cervical spine.

Treatment can also help improve proprioception—your body's awareness of the position and movement of your neck—which is important for how you control and move your head and neck during everyday activities.

Combining Hands-On Treatment With Exercise

While manual therapy can provide pain relief and improve mobility, treatment shouldn't stop there. The goal is to improve long-term function and reduce the likelihood of recurring headaches.

Research supports combining hands-on manual therapy with specific, targeted therapeutic exercise for people with cervicogenic headaches. Exercise helps build on the improvements made through hands-on treatment by addressing strength, endurance, mobility, and movement patterns that may be contributing to recurring symptoms.

Why Exercise Matters for Cervicogenic Headaches

While spinal adjustments or massage can feel great and provide relief, exercise is a key part of creating lasting improvements. Exercise therapy for cervicogenic headaches is multifaceted and incorporates not only the neck, but the upper back and shoulders as well.

Depending on what we find during your assessment, your exercise program may include the following:

Deep Neck Flexor Training

Your deep neck flexors act as the vital “core” muscles of your cervical spine. Reduced strength or endurance in these muscles is commonly seen in people with cervicogenic headaches.

Specific, low-load exercises help recruit, train, and strengthen these deep muscles, improving the stability and control of your neck and helping reduce recurring symptoms.

Postural Strengthening

Strengthening the postural muscles of your mid-back, lower neck, and shoulder blades helps you maintain comfortable positions for longer periods and reduces the daily demands placed on your upper neck.

This can be especially important if you spend long hours working at a computer, driving, studying, or in other sustained positions.

Upper Back Mobility Exercises

If your upper back is stiff, your neck may have to work harder and compensate for the lack of mobility. Targeted mobility exercises help keep your thoracic spine moving well and allow your neck and upper back to share the demands of everyday movement.

Building Endurance for Daily Activities

Why does muscular endurance matter so much? Because muscles that lack endurance fatigue quickly.

You might be strong enough to lift heavy weights at the gym, but that doesn't necessarily mean the stabilizing muscles of your neck have the endurance to support you through an eight-hour workday.

When these muscles fatigue, more demand can be placed on other structures in the neck, including the joints, ligaments, discs, and joint capsules. Building muscular endurance helps your neck better handle the physical demands of work, exercise, driving, and everyday activities without repeatedly aggravating your symptoms.

The goal isn't just to help you feel better. It's to build the strength, mobility, and endurance your body needs to stay better.

FAQs About Cervicogenic Headaches

Can neck pain cause headaches?
Yes. Research suggests that up to 90% of people with migraine or tension-type headaches also experience neck pain. In a cervicogenic headache, pain originating from structures in the upper neck can be referred into the head due to shared nerve pathways in the brainstem, including the trigeminocervical nucleus.

What does a cervicogenic headache feel like?
It typically feels like a dull, aching pain that starts in the neck or at the base of the skull and travels forward toward the front of the head, temple, or behind the eye. The pain is commonly one-sided and may be accompanied by neck stiffness or reduced mobility. It can also be aggravated by certain neck movements or prolonged positions.

How do I know if my headache is coming from my neck?
Some of the strongest clues are headaches that consistently occur on the same side, noticeable neck stiffness or reduced range of motion, and symptoms that are reliably triggered or worsened by neck movement or prolonged positions. A clinical assessment can help determine whether your neck is contributing to your headaches and distinguish a cervicogenic headache from other headache types.

Can chiropractic treatment help headaches?
Yes. Research supports manual therapy, including spinal manipulation and joint mobilization, for reducing headache intensity, frequency, and disability in people with cervicogenic headaches. At 416 Physio, we combine hands-on treatment with targeted exercise and rehabilitation to address the factors contributing to recurring symptoms.

What exercises help cervicogenic headaches?
Exercise for cervicogenic headaches typically includes a combination of deep neck flexor training, upper-back mobility exercises, and strengthening and endurance exercises for the neck, shoulders, and mid-back. This comprehensive approach helps improve neck function and builds the strength and endurance needed to support longer-term improvements.
